Africa Oil & Gas: Equatorial Guinea to Offer Up Fortuna Acreage

Equatorial Guinea plans to offer up acreage offshore Block R with the related Fortuna gas development project in its April licensing round, after the concession was reclaimed from Ophir Energy, Gabriel Obiang Lima, the country’s oil minister, was quoted as saying in a Reuters report.

Africa Oil & Gas: Equatorial Guniea Minister Cracks Down on Subsea 7

Equatorial Guinea’s Minister of Mines and Hydrocarbons, Gabriel Mbaga Obiang Lima, at the South Sudan Oil and Power Conference in Juba. announced the decision to mandate all petroleum operators cancel any contracts with US-based oil service company Subsea 7, due to noncompliance of Equatorial Guinea’s local content regulations.
